Understanding Bottle Inspection
Bottle inspection is a critical quality control process that ensures bottles are clean, free of damage, and devoid of contaminants before they are filled. This step is vital to prevent product waste, maintain consumer safety, and uphold product quality. Different industries, such as beverages, pharmaceuticals, and cosmetics, have unique requirements, leading to various inspection methods tailored to their needs.
Importance of Empty Bottle Inspection
Empty bottle inspection (EBI) plays a significant role in the production line. It helps in identifying foreign objects and flaws in bottles, ensuring that only perfect containers proceed to the filling stage. Cap and Closure Inspection
In addition to inspecting empty bottles, verifying the integrity of caps and closures is also essential. Systems from www.mt.com focus on ensuring that caps are properly placed and free from defects. This process is crucial for preventing leaks and contamination, thereby safeguarding consumer health.
Filled Bottle Inspection
After bottling, filled bottles undergo a second inspection to check for volume discrepancies, foreign particles, and defective seals. This step is crucial in industries like food and beverages, where product consistency and safety are paramount. Best Practices for Bottle Inspection
To maximize the effectiveness of bottle inspection systems, several best practices should be implemented:
Regular Maintenance
Regular servicing of inspection equipment is essential to ensure optimal performance. This includes cleaning, calibration, and software updates. Following the SOPs outlined on sites like pharmaguddu.com can help maintain system efficacy.
Training Personnel
Proper training for staff operating inspection systems is crucial. Understanding the equipment’s capabilities and limitations can significantly reduce the risk of human error during inspections.
Data Analysis and Reporting
Collecting and analyzing data from inspection results can provide insights into recurring issues, enabling continuous improvement in production processes. This practice is common among industry leaders and aligns with quality management principles.
Compliance with Standards
Ensuring that the inspection process complies with industry regulations is vital. This includes adhering to safety standards and maintaining documentation for audits.
Supplier Audits and Quality Control
Conducting regular audits of suppliers and maintaining strict quality control measures can help mitigate risks associated with sourcing bottles, especially from overseas manufacturers.

FAQ
What is empty bottle inspection?
Empty bottle inspection is a quality control process that ensures bottles are clean, free from defects, and devoid of contaminants before filling.
Why is cap inspection important?
Cap inspection prevents leaks and contamination by ensuring that caps are correctly placed and free from defects, maintaining product integrity.
What technologies are used in bottle inspection?
Technologies used include optical sensors, imaging systems, and mechanical checks to detect flaws and ensure quality.
How often should inspection systems be maintained?
Regular maintenance should be conducted according to the manufacturer’s recommendations, typically every few months or after significant production changes.
What role does data analysis play in bottle inspection?
Data analysis helps identify trends and recurring issues, allowing companies to make informed decisions that enhance production quality and efficiency.
What industries utilize bottle inspection systems?
Industries such as beverages, pharmaceuticals, cosmetics, and food rely on bottle inspection systems to ensure product quality and safety.
What are the consequences of poor bottle inspection?
Poor bottle inspection can lead to contaminated or defective products, resulting in waste, consumer safety risks, and damage to brand reputation.
